Getech, based in Leeds, specialises in data-mapping natural resources such as metals, minerals and geothermal energy — the company uses its geoscience data and geospatial software to accelerate energy transition away from fossil fuels by developing and leading geo-energy and natural hydrogen projects.
Getech is partly utilising the funding from Reward to further invest in its data capabilities and adopt a new approach to locating metals in previously unexplored territories.
Andrew Darbyshire, CFO at Getech (pictured above, right), said: “We’re at a pivotal stage of our business growth and needed an agile funding solution that ensures we don’t standstill.
“It’s critical that we continue to diversify, explore new market opportunities within green energy and remain focused on our core goals of finding the natural resources vital for the energy transition.
